Technically these are BFR's there were 5 total of the seafoam green I believe, and it had a sealed neck, so description is accurate but that one is in bad shape IMO

There were two other colors made in this very limited run, a pine green color and as mentioned a coral red, those colors had the all rosewood neck, I so wanted a seafoam green one but by the time i got to the DIGF all were sold to dealers and others,
